Self-Contained Heating

Wood stoves are heating units that can be used in a variety of ways. They produce radiant heat, and smoke is emitted through the chimney. They are perfect for homes that have a natural draft or lack central heating and air conditioning. They are typically installed in living rooms and family spaces where the sound of a fireplace can be the most relaxing. They can also be found in basements and bedrooms. They are a great option for those who want to lower their energy bills and energy consumption during winter.

The majority of modern wood stoves are more efficient than previous models due to new Ecodesign regulations. They consume more fuel at a higher rate and consume less fuel. This generates more heat for your home. They also emit fewer harmful gases into the air. This makes them a more sustainable alternative to electric and gas heaters.

You can choose from a range of styles of wood stoves from traditional enameled Vermont Castings to more modern soapstone by Hearthstone or Woodstock. They are available in a variety of colors and designs to fit in with any space in your house. They can be used to accent an area or serve as a focal point in your interior.

Another reason why people love wood stoves is that they offer a sense of being independent from electricity. Wood stoves are a reliable backup heat source, and can be used to cook and heat water as well. If you live in a region where power outages are frequent the wood stove could be very useful in these instances.

Modern Designs

There are so many styles of wood stoves that they can fit into any home design. Some models even feature elegant and stylish accents that add a touch of style to the room. Modern wood stoves are also available for those who prefer a more sustainable alternative. They burn clean, generating less smoke and ash than conventional models. Modern wood stoves require less energy.

You'll want to choose the stove model that best suits your home's climate and heating needs. If you live in a region that is colder, you may be interested in a catalytic stove. These models feature honeycomb devices that are coated with reactive metal that aids in making the stove to burn more efficiently by forcing gasses and vapors through at lower temperatures. Catalytic stoves boast 78% greater efficiency than non-catalytic versions. They are great for cold climates and for those who use their stoves as their primary heating source.

The multi fuel wood stove is a different type of wood stove that is becoming more popular in the United States. It can burn wood in addition to other fuels, like coal and smokeless fuels like peat. The minimalist design of the multi-fuel stove can be seen by its minimalist features, such as the guillotine door and the window that you can open and close by using just a few fingers.

Simple to operate

A wood stove creates an atmosphere of warmth with the scents and sounds that emanate from a burning fireplace. It can be used as a cooking stove, and it complements many contemporary home decor styles. It's more economical to operate than an open fireplace and can keep your living area warm during cold southeast NY winter nights. Wood stoves are now more efficient than they have ever been. They lose less heat through the chimney and can effectively heat a living room or cabin up to 2,500 square feet.

The ideal wood stove for you is based on three aspects: the amount of heat you need as well as the size of your room and the location where it's to be installed. You can choose from convective, radiating, or a combination.

Radiant models radiate heat in all directions while convective models transfer heat to walls and furniture. If you need to heat a large area, think about the combination of a convective and radiant stove. Convective models provide lower heat output than radiating models, however they are more easy to clean and maintain.

The most important thing to do is choose the right size stove for your space. Ask a professional to calculate the Btu required for your room. Once you've calculated that, you can determine the size of the stove you'll need.
